    Dance, Beats and a Big Party: Over 10,000 Fans at the Red Bull Dance Your Style Final in Prague

    From Brno to Los Angeles: Two Czech Dancers Head to the World Final in California

    On Saturday, the Křižík Fountain in Prague became the stage for the national final of Red Bull Dance Your Style 2025. The big winner of the evening was Brno’s Jan “Lil H” Ničovský, who thereby qualified for the world final in Los Angeles this October.

    The Prague Exhibition Grounds in Holešovice were all about music, dance and a captivating show on Saturday, 20 September. The Křižík Fountain (Křižíkova fontána) was transformed into a large open-air stage, hosting dance performances, DJ sets and a concert by Slovak rapper Sára Rikas throughout the day. The highlight of the evening was the national final of Red Bull Dance Your Style 2025.

    Semi-Finals at Sunset in Front of Thousands of Fans

    Already in the afternoon, the first performances at the Křižík Fountain created an atmosphere that grew stronger with each act. At sunset the semi-finals began: 16 street dance performers faced off in one-on-one duels – without knowing what music awaited them. From Michael Jackson to Ben Cristovao and even Vivaldi, everything was included, and the audience responded each time with thunderous applause. The winners of each battle were chosen by the crowd, whose wristbands changed to blue or red after every duel. More than 10,000 fans fired up the atmosphere, which was lifted once again before the final by the performance of Sára Rikas.

    Duel from the Same Crew

    In the grand final, two dancers from the same Brno crew, MoGG, faced each other: Jan “Lil H” Ničovský, the youngest participant in the competition, and Sebastian “Sebastián” Nicolas Šipoš, who had qualified through the open heats in June. The emotional battle ended with a clear audience vote for Lil H. “It was an incredibly powerful experience, every battle gave me even more energy,” said the newly crowned winner with a laugh after the decision. Ničovský, who already won the prestigious Street Dance Kemp Europe earlier this year, is regarded as one of the biggest talents on the young dance scene. His style: uncompromising, technically demanding hip hop, which for him is far more than just dance – it is both a form of expression and a way of life.

    Two Representatives from the Czech Republic at the World Final

    The Czech Republic will be represented twice at the world final in Los Angeles: alongside newly crowned champion Ničovský, Viktor Bukový from the Brno crew High Edition will also travel. He received a wildcard from the international organisers. Bukový is a leading figure in the Czech and Slovak waacking scene and has been making his mark internationally for years.

    Foto: Red Bull Dance Your Style 2025 | Red Bull CZ

    With Red Bull Dance Your Style, more than 30 countries worldwide are searching for personalities who impress with their dance and charisma. On 11 October in Los Angeles, the best of the best will face each other – and the Czech Republic is sending two dancers into the race for the coveted title.
